Strikeout props are not only my favorite MLB bets, but they are also (by far) my most profitable! Strikeout rates for both pitchers and hitters stabilize more quickly than most other stats in baseball, making them some of the most predictive stats that we have in the game. We can dig into recent trends and lineup changes for teams to find an extra edge, but modeling strikeout predictions is something I've done for nearly five years. More often than not, I can find inefficiencies in the strikeout prop market.

Max Meyer OVER 5.5 strikeouts (-112 FanDuel)

Meyer will face the New York Mets for the second time in a row, and I know some bettors are leery of betting on a repeat performance by a pitcher who went over his K prop against a team in the previous start.

But Meyer cleared that prop by an extra two strikeouts, whiffing eight Mets over seven innings for his third straight outing with six or more strikeouts. He's now gone for six or more in five of his last seven outings, with those two misses being on the hook right at five Ks.

Meyer's numbers are legit this season, as his 27% K% is backed by a strong 13.8% SwStr%. As long as he keeps leaning heavily on his very good breaking balls (he has a very good slider AND sweeper), he should keep racking up good strikeout totals.

This Mets' lineup is trending up in strikeout rate against righties, too, as young hitters like Brett Baty, A.J. Ewing, and MJ Melendez are all whiffing at extremely high rates (30% or higher).

Taj Bradley OVER 5.5 strikeouts (-139 Novig)

Jared Jones is getting all the buzz in this matchup, as he's set to make his 2026 debut for the Pirates tonight against the Twins. His prop has already been bet up to 5.5 in most places, or 4.5 with a ton of juice, so while I will be rooting for a strong start from Jones for my hometown Bucs, I don't really want to bet on him.

I do love Taj Bradley on the other side of this matchup, however. Bradley had a strong outing against the Red Sox in his return from a brief injury stint, striking out seven Red Sox over five frames.

He's now gone for six or more strikeouts in six of his nine starts this season and is sitting at a 27% K% this season.

The Pirates are trending up in K% against RHP lately, with a 23.9% K% over the last two weeks, which is the seventh-worst mark in MLB. They are really missing Ryan O'Hearn right now, who has been replaced by a higher strikeout hitter most nights, whether it's Jake Mangum or Jhostynxon Garcia.

Brandon Lowe, Bryan Reynolds, Oneil Cruz, and Marcell Ozuna have also been high-strikeout hitters this season. So if Bradley can avoid any big innings early, I think he can cruise to six or more strikeouts tonight.
